How much do digital program coordinator j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 6, 2026, the average yearly pay for digital program coordinator in Arkansas is $48,722.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$36,400.00 and $58,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a digital program coordinator do?

A Digital Program Coordinator manages and oversees digital projects and campaigns within an organization. Their main responsibilities include coordinating tasks between teams, tracking project timelines, ensuring deliverables are met, and reporting on progress. They often work with digital marketing, content creation, and web development teams to execute digital strategies effectively. Strong organizational and communication skills are essential, as well as a solid understanding of digital tools and platforms. The role may also involve analyzing project data to optimize future campaigns.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a digital program coordinator?

To thrive as a Digital Program Coordinator, you need strong project management abilities, organizational skills, and a background in communications or marketing, often supported by a relevant degree. Familiarity with digital project management tools (such as Asana or Trello), content management systems, and basic data analytics platforms is typically required. Excellent communication, adaptability, and problem-solving skills help you collaborate effectively and manage multiple priorities. These abilities are essential for keeping digital initiatives on track and ensuring the successful execution of complex programs.

What are some common challenges faced by digital program coordinators when managing multiple digital projects simultaneously?

Digital Program Coordinators often juggle several projects at once, which can make prioritization and time management challenging. Coordinators must ensure that all stakeholders are aligned, deadlines are met, and project objectives are clear, all while balancing shifting priorities and unexpected issues. Effective communication, adaptability, and strong organizational skills are essential to prevent bottlenecks and maintain project momentum. Collaborating closely with cross-functional teams—such as marketing, IT, and design—also requires diplomacy and proactive problem-solving.

Job description

Position Summary... What you'll do...Role summary:
Join the fast-growing Sam’s Club Creator & Influencer team, where technology, digital marketing, commerce, and creative storytelling come together. In this role, you’ll be at the center of day-to-day program execution supporting creators through onboarding, communications, troubleshooting, and ongoing engagement while helping the program run smoothly at scale. You’ll also play a key role in outreach, content coordination, and platform support across social and internal tools. This is a highly hands-on position where you’ll solve real-time problems, experiment with new approaches, and directly improve the creator experience as the program rapidly evolves and expands.
About the team:
The Sam’s Club Creator & Influencer team is shaping how Sam’s Club connects with audiences through people, platforms, and culture. We sit at the intersection of technology, digital marketing strategy, social commerce, and creative storytelling. Our work spans influencer partnerships, affiliate growth, social innovation, platform development, and the operations that power it all. We move quickly, test often, and bring a builder mindset to everything we do as we scale a rapidly growing program.
What you'll do:
  • Manage day-to-day support through the program inbox, including payment questions, program inquiries, and troubleshooting.
  • Support recruiting, outreach, onboarding, and retention efforts via email and social channels.
  • Publish social content and respond to comments and DMs across creator social platforms.
  • Contribute to content creation including social-first storytelling, product features, educational materials, and program resources across channels.
  • Surface recurring issues, feedback, and opportunities to improve the creator experience.

What you'll bring:
  • Strong written communication and a thoughtful, service-oriented approach.
  • Excellent organization, attention to detail, and follow-through.
  • Ability to learn quickly, solve problems, and man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
  • Comfort working across email, social platforms, and digital tools.
  • Curiosity about influencer marketing, social media, technology, and digital commerce.
  • A hands-on, team-first mindset and willingness to jump into both strategic and operational work.
  • Prior influencer or creator experience is a plus, but not required.
